Mysql
 sql >> база данни >  >> RDS >> Mysql

Методът getColumnName в ResultSetMeta не може да върне правилното име на колона (jdbc)

Изглежда като DESC е просто пряк път за заявка на информационната схема с псевдоними за колоните.

Псевдонимите на колони могат да бъдат извлечени с ResultSetMetadata.getColumnLabel(int) .

JDBC дефинира етикета на колоната като:

Това също означава, че в почти всички ситуации трябва да използвате getColumnLabel вместо getColumnName .




  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. SQLException :Преди началото на набора от резултати

  2. Как да пресъздам база данни от стара база данни с помощта на sequelize в node.js

  3. Разширението mysql е отхвърлено и ще бъде премахнато в бъдеще:вместо това използвайте mysqli или PDO

  4. Инсталиране на MySQL-Python - Не можа да се изгради яйцето

  5. При импортиране на MySQL:ГРЕШКА на ред 32769:Неизвестна команда „\“